President of the Republic visited Saaremaa
05.07.2000

President Lennart Meri visited the Rectory of Valjala at Saaremaa yesterday with Uffe Ellemann-Jensen, the former Foreign Minister of Denmark; they met Gustav Kutsar, the minister of the St. Martin's congregation of Valjala, and Kaido Kaasik, who is the chairman of the board of the congregation. Gustav Kutsar and Kaido Kaasik spoke in detail of the history of the building of the church to the Head of State and his guest Uffe Ellemann-Jensen, the former Foreign Minister of Denmark. The President was also offered eel soup at the rectory.

The President was invited to Valjala by Gustav Kutsar on the President's reception to the best university graduates in Kadriorg at June 21, where the minister was present as a graduate of the Institute of Theology of the Estonian Evangelical Lutheran Church. Gustav Kutsar is also the Chairman of the Valjala Government Council and Kaido Kaasik is the rural municipality mayor of Valjala, and also the general welfare of the Valjala rural municipality was discussed on the meeting with the President.

Today the President also visited Undva in the north-western part of Saaremaa, which is one of the potential sites for the deep sea port. In the afternoon, the President and his delegation were at Kuressaare, and made a tour in the city and in the bishop's castle.

President Lennart Meri also visited the joint stock company ''Saare paat'' at Nasva, where the yacht ''Lennuk'', sailing around the world under the Estonian flag, had been built. President of the Republic is the patron of this trip around the world. Also the construction of a Viking ship and other shipbuilding activities were demonstrated to the President.

President Lennart Meri yesterday first visited Muhumaa and the Pädaste estate, and then travelled on to Saaremaa, where he had a meeting with Heinrich von Pierer, Director General of Siemens AG, in the evening of July 3. The President will return from Saaremaa this evening.
